在投身游戏开发这一充满创意与挑战的领域时,开发者需要系统性地关注一系列核心环节,以确保项目的顺利进行与最终产品的成功。这些注意事项构成了游戏制作的基石,贯穿于从概念萌芽到最终发布的完整周期。
创意与设计层面 首要环节是确立清晰且独特的核心玩法与世界观。一个吸引人的游戏概念是项目的灵魂,需要兼顾创新性与可实现性。同时,游戏的叙事结构、角色设定以及视觉艺术风格必须与核心玩法高度契合,形成统一的体验基调。在此阶段,明确的用户画像与市场定位也至关重要,这决定了游戏的整体方向。 技术与实现层面 技术选型与架构设计是支撑创意落地的骨架。选择适合的游戏引擎与开发工具,并构建稳定、可扩展的代码框架,能有效避免后期开发陷入困境。性能优化需从项目早期就纳入考量,包括图形渲染效率、内存管理和网络通信等,以确保游戏在不同设备上都能流畅运行。此外,建立系统化的测试流程,及时发现并修复程序错误与逻辑漏洞,是保障产品稳定性的关键。 团队与流程层面 高效的团队协作与项目管理是项目成功的润滑剂。明确的职责划分、顺畅的沟通机制以及合理的开发里程碑,能够确保团队成员同步前进。采用敏捷开发等迭代式方法,有助于灵活应对需求变化,并通过持续集成与版本控制来管理复杂的资产与代码。团队内部的创意碰撞与技能互补,往往能激发出更出色的解决方案。 用户与市场层面 最终,一切努力都指向用户体验与市场接纳。深入理解目标玩家的需求与习惯,通过早期原型测试获取反馈并持续迭代,是打磨精品的不二法门。同时,需要考虑游戏的商业化模式、发布后的长期运营计划以及社区维护策略,为游戏注入持久的生命力。尊重玩家,创造价值,是游戏得以在激烈竞争中脱颖而出的根本。游戏开发是一项融合了艺术、技术与商业的复杂系统工程。要成功制作出一款令人满意的游戏,开发者必须在多个维度上保持高度专注与周密规划。以下将从几个相互关联的宏观领域,深入剖析其中需要特别注意的核心事项。
一、 创意构思与游戏设计领域 这是整个项目的起点,决定了游戏的基因与吸引力上限。首先,核心玩法的独创性与可玩性是重中之重。玩法不应是现有机制的简单堆砌,而应寻求在交互逻辑、策略深度或情感体验上带来新鲜感。同时,玩法必须经过反复推敲与微型原型验证,确保其乐趣持久,而非浅尝辄止。 其次,叙事与世界的融合度需要精心雕琢。对于故事驱动型游戏,情节的起承转合、角色的成长弧光必须引人入胜;对于玩法主导型游戏,世界观的设定也需要为玩法提供合理的背景与动机,增强玩家的沉浸感。视觉与听觉的艺术风格,包括色彩、造型、界面布局和音效配乐,都应服务于统一的主题氛围,形成独特的审美标识。 最后,设计的前瞻性与文档化不容忽视。详细的设计文档不仅是团队内的沟通蓝图,也能帮助开发者预见潜在的设计矛盾或内容规模失控。设计应具备一定的灵活性,为后续的迭代优化留出空间。 二、 技术开发与工程实现领域 此领域是将创意转化为可运行产品的关键,充满了具体而微的挑战。技术选型与架构规划是基础。根据游戏类型、目标平台和团队技术栈,审慎选择游戏引擎或自研框架。一个清晰、模块化、低耦合的软件架构能极大提升开发效率,便于多人协作和功能扩展。 性能优化贯穿始终。这包括图形层面的绘制调用优化、材质与着色器管理;内存层面的资源加载与释放策略,避免泄漏;以及代码层面的算法效率。对于网络游戏,还需特别关注网络同步、数据传输压缩与反作弊机制。性能问题若堆积到开发后期,往往积重难返。 质量保障体系必须建立健全。这不仅仅是发现程序错误,更包括游戏平衡性测试、用户体验流程测试、多平台兼容性测试以及压力测试。自动化测试的引入可以覆盖大量重复性校验,而人工探索性测试则能发现自动化难以捕捉的交互与逻辑问题。 三、 团队协作与项目管理领域 再出色的创意与技术,也需要依靠高效的团队来实现。明确的角色分工与沟通文化是团队运转的基石。策划、程序、美术、音效等各职能间需要建立共同的语言和评审流程,确保信息无损传递。定期的站会、评审会以及使用协同工具,能保持目标一致。 采用科学的项目管理方法至关重要。无论是敏捷开发、瀑布模型还是混合模式,核心在于制定切实可行的开发计划,将宏大目标分解为可执行、可衡量的短期任务。管理好需求变更,评估其对进度与资源的影响,避免项目范围无限蔓延。 此外,资产与版本管理是维持秩序的生命线。使用专业的版本控制系统管理代码,并建立规范的资源命名、存储和导入流程,可以避免资产丢失、版本混乱等灾难性问题,特别是在大型团队中。 四、 用户体验与市场运营领域 游戏最终是面向玩家的产品,因此必须时刻以用户为中心。早期与持续的用户测试是获取真实反馈的宝贵途径。通过内部体验、封闭测试和公开测试,收集玩家在操作手感、难度曲线、理解成本、情感共鸣等方面的意见,并据此快速迭代。 商业化设计需注重平衡。无论采用买断制、内购制还是广告模式,其设计都应与核心玩法体验有机结合,避免破坏游戏的公平性与沉浸感。定价策略、虚拟物品的价值体系需要经过精心设计,既体现开发价值,又能被玩家社区所接受。 最后,发布后的长期运营与社区建设决定了游戏的生命周期。这包括持续的内容更新、活动策划、技术维护、客户服务以及与玩家社群的良性互动。建立一个积极、健康的玩家社区,能够为游戏带来持久的口碑和生命力。 总而言之,制作游戏是一场需要兼顾灵感与理性、艺术与工艺、创作与服务的马拉松。在上述每个领域保持清醒的认识与系统的准备,方能有效规避风险,稳步推进,最终将脑海中的精彩世界,完美地呈现给广大玩家。
146人看过